Soothing Herbal Powerhouse with Soft Blooms and Silky Roots Marshmallow (Althaea officinalis) is a medicinal herb and flowering perennial treasured for centuries for its soothing, mucilaginous roots and leaves. Native to Europe and Western Asia, this soft, silvery plant is the original source of the sweet we know today—but its true gift lies in its ability to calm inflammation, support digestion, and soothe the respiratory tract. The plant features velvety leaves and pale pink hibiscus-like flowers, loved by pollinators and perfect for herb gardens, cottage borders, and apothecary patches. Its roots, leaves, and flowers are traditionally used in teas, syrups, and salves to ease sore throats, coughs, and skin irritations. Marshmallow grows best in moist, well-draining soil with full to part sun and is particularly suited to medicinal gardens, wetland edges, and temperate food forests.
